Members ShortBBL Posted October 31, 2010 Members Report Posted October 31, 2010 I found a decent deal on a Holster and bought it, only to find out it had a masking tape "price tag" on the front! Ugh..... here is a picture of how it looks after I took the tape off. Any good ideas what might help to clean this off and then what to do to restore it to a good looking piece of leather? Thanks! King's X Posted October 31, 2010 Report Posted October 31, 2010 I use a gum eraser and it works quite well.....but caution, do not rub too hard or you will disburb the finish. You can try a bit of Goo-Gone, that should work without disturbing the finish. Good luck. Quote
Members js5972 Posted November 13, 2010 Members Report Posted November 13, 2010 I found some stuff called Elmer's Sticky Out at Office Max. Takes off masking & clear tape residue quite well from wood surface. I would definitely try it on the backside first to make sure it doesn't eat the finish. Also I've had some sucess with WD 40.
